Developing, parenting

LGBT people of all ages remain likely to deal with coming-out issues, doctors report. Young adults, though, are more inclined to deal with many post-coming-out trouble, since many are going to actually have come out for their mothers, says Marny Hall, PhD, a psychotherapist and specialist in San Francisco Bay area. While that’s often good news, she observes, frequently their moms and dads’ approval is conditional.

“Parents will show a kind of restricted threshold for his or her ‘queer’ kids–what I name tolerance without equality,” hallway claims. “the customers I discover are constantly confronted with problems similar to this.”

LGBT clients are also working with the flip area of these formula: being mothers themselves. Numerous lesbians and homosexual men are the very first generation of homosexuals having young children who’re getting teens. Some discovered that while as younger children they had no problem acknowledging their particular homosexual moms and dads, because they move into puberty, some adolescents start to feeling embarrassed by their unique mothers’ homosexuality, claims Haldeman.

“Some young people are actually conflicted that can just be sure to cover the actual fact they have two same-sex parents with mom and dad pick them up from school in a few key venue,” the guy says–dynamics which affect the child’s partnership with mothers and associates as well as the moms and dads’ partnership.

Another spin on the child-rearing concern is that today, gays and lesbians has children not just from demolished heterosexual marriages, but from broken-up homosexual relationships nicely, Hall brings. Disputes concerning children of same-sex unions existing certain troubles because the legal surface for same-sex people in addition to their child-custody rights “is moving all the time,” she states.

“when there will be no clear guidelines, exactly what frequently replacements is disputes inside the couples,” hallway claims. “Relationship issues really can have played in this arena.”

Psychologists become assisting these people different parenting difficulties from union troubles and creating systems that do not call for legal buildings to make usage of, she claims.
